[发明专利]一种金融数据处理方法及装置在审
申请号: | 201910293721.9 | 申请日: | 2019-04-12 |
公开(公告)号: | CN110020952A | 公开(公告)日: | 2019-07-16 |
发明(设计)人: | 不公告发明人 | 申请(专利权)人: | 李升东 |
主分类号: | G06Q40/04 | 分类号: | G06Q40/04 |
代理公司: | 北京超凡宏宇专利代理事务所(特殊普通合伙) 11463 | 代理人: | 崔振 |
地址: | 200120 上海市浦*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 金融数据 数据队列 金融数据处理 策略算法 数据处理领域 数据处理效率 调度 服务器传输 属性信息 预设规则 运算 申请 | ||
本申请提供了一种金融数据处理方法及装置,涉及数据处理领域,其中,该方法包括:获取交易所服务器传输的金融数据;根据预设规则以及金融数据的属性信息,将上述金融数据调度至对应的数据队列;采用每个数据队列对应的策略算法处理该数据队列中的金融数据,获取每个数据队列对应的策略结果。实现了在获取金融数据后可以及时调度到对应的数据队列,并可以同步进行多个策略算法的运算,大大减少了锁的使用,大幅提升数据处理效率。
技术领域
本申请涉及投资和风险管理领域,具体而言,涉及一种金融数据处理方法及装置。
背景技术
在金融产品、金融衍生品(例如股票、期货、期权、债券、外汇、基金等)的交易过程中,有很多的不可预期因素会影响交易结果。越来越多的研究人员希望通过大量的数据分析、处理等过程,来更好的辅助金融产品、金融衍生品交易。
现有技术中,获取金融数据后,会采用对应的算法对金融数据进行处理,并获取处理结果,用户可以参考处理结果进行交易。但是现有的数据处理过程中,在数据运算、数据调度过程中需要频繁使用各种锁来分配和管理资源与事件优先级,导致大量计算延迟和处理效率低下。
发明内容
有鉴于此,本申请实施例的目的在于提供一种金融数据处理方法及装置,能够提升金融数据的处理效率。
第一方面,本申请提供一种金融数据处理方法,包括:
获取交易所服务器传输的金融数据;
根据预设规则以及所述金融数据的属性信息,将金融数据调度至对应的数据队列;
采用每个数据队列对应的策略算法处理数据队列中的金融数据,获取每个数据队列对应的策略结果。
第二方面,本申请提供一种金融数据处理装置,包括:
获取模块,用于获取交易所服务器传输的金融数据;
调度模块,用于根据预设规则以及金融数据的属性信息,将金融数据调度至对应的数据队列;
策略模块,用于采用每个数据队列对应的策略算法处理数据队列中的金融数据,获取每个数据队列对应的策略结果。
第三方面,提供一种处理设备,可以包括存储有计算机程序的计算机可读存储介质和处理器,所述计算机程序被所述处理器读取并运行时,实现上述第一方面所述的方法。
第四方面,提出一种计算机可读存储介质,其上存储有计算机程序,所述计算机程序被处理器读取并运行时,实现上述第一方面所述的方法。
本申请实施例中,将从交易所服务器获取的金融数据根据预设规则以及金融数据的属性信息,将金融数据调度至对应的数据队列,采用每个数据队列对应的策略算法处理数据队列中的金融数据,获取每个数据队列对应的策略结果,实现了在获取金融数据后可以及时调度到对应的数据队列,并可以同步进行多个策略算法的运算,大大减少了锁的使用,提升数据处理效率。
附图说明
为了更清楚地说明本申请实施例的技术方案,下面将对实施例中所需要使用的附图作简单地介绍,应当理解,以下附图仅示出了本申请的某些实施例,因此不应被看作是对范围的限定,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他相关的附图。
图1为本申请提供的金融数据处理方法应用场景示意图;
图2为本申请一实施例提供的金融数据处理方法流程示意图;
图3为本申请另一实施例提供的金融数据处理方法流程示意图;
图4为本申请另一实施例提供的金融数据处理方法流程示意图;
图5为本申请一实施例提供的金融数据处理装置结构示意图;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于李升东,未经李升东许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910293721.9/2.html,转载请声明来源钻瓜专利网。